Hi,
I'm trying to record the midi output from dsptrigger and I don't have any clue how to do it in reaper 4.12.
Any ideas ?

It's obviously much easier to just record the audio and leave DSP Trigger running. It's easy on the CPU, so you don't have to worry about taking a hit in that regard.

But if you really want to record the MIDI, you'll need to use two tracks: one for DSP Trigger, another for your sampler. The trick it to set the record mode to MIDI for the track with DSP Trigger on it. This will cause it to record the MIDI output by DSP Trigger instead of the audio going into its input. You can do this by right-clicking on track's VU meter area and setting the 'Record Output' to MIDI. Next, open the track's Input / Output section and add a send to the track with your sampler on it.

Maybe sure the track with DSP Trigger is record armed and that the monitor is on and you're all set.

FYI, It's important to keep DSP Trigger and your sampler on separate tracks. If they are on the same track, the sampler will consume the MIDI and won't pass it on to the output of the track and therefore it won't be recorded.
